This coming weekend will be the Scratch Championship (open to golfers with handicaps between 0 & 7) and the Handicap Cup (open to golfers with handicaps between 8 and 15 inclusive). These competitions will follow the traditional medal format. 

There will be a separate competition for golfers with handicaps 16+ which will be a maximum score medal. If you reach the maximum score of 5 over the gross par on a hole, you must pick up your ball and mark the maximum score on your scorecard.

Scorecards.

We politely remind you that scorecards will continue to be marked by one person for each group. A verbal confirmation of scores during and at the end of the round is acceptable, a second signature is not required at this time. Please take a legible photograph of the card, showing player names, handicaps, scores and signature and send them via text, email or WhatsApp to the addresses shown on the scorecard box outside of the Clubhouse. Please send these before midnight on the day of the competition.

Recently, there have been several cards not returned. This has required handling of the scorecards in order to process them. Whilst precautions are taken in the handling of the cards, it is an unnecessary risk and therefore sanctions will have to be in place for future competitions.

Crow Nest Cup.

A decision was taken earlier this month to temporarily change the qualification criteria for the Crow Nest Cup to the top 20% of finishers in competitions. Due to the unprecedented number of players in our recent competitions, this temporary change will revert back to the top 10% upon reaching 90 qualifiers.
